René 77

René 77 provides strong gamma prime precipitation hardening alongside solid-solution cobalt and molybdenum additions, giving reliable creep rupture life and tensile strength for cast turbine blades and vanes. Qualified under C50TF15, C50T67, and DMD 0437-32, it is used in aerospace and military gas turbine applications where consistent elevated-temperature performance and good casting yield are required. Its balanced chemistry supports both equiaxed and DS casting approaches.
